Successful Marine Education Program Models

Hands-On Learning Programs

Immersive, hands-on experiences form the cornerstone of effective marine education, offering participants direct engagement with coastal ecosystems and marine life. These programs provide unique opportunities to explore and understand ocean biodiversity through guided activities and expert instruction.

Tide pool exploration sessions allow participants to discover the intricate relationships between intertidal species while learning about adaptation and survival strategies. Under the guidance of experienced marine biologists, visitors carefully navigate these delicate ecosystems, identifying various organisms from sea stars and anemones to hermit crabs and mollusks.

Marine life observation programs utilize both shore-based and boat-based approaches. Shore-based activities include whale watching from strategic coastal viewpoints, while boat excursions offer closer encounters with marine mammals, seabirds, and other pelagic species. Participants learn proper observation techniques, species identification, and responsible wildlife viewing practices.

Interactive touch tanks provide controlled environments where participants can safely handle various marine creatures while learning about their characteristics and behaviors. These supervised experiences are particularly effective for younger learners, fostering a deep connection with marine life through direct contact.

Field sampling activities introduce participants to scientific methodologies used in marine research. Under expert supervision, participants learn to collect and analyze water samples, conduct population surveys, and document species distribution, contributing to ongoing research while gaining practical experience in marine science techniques.

Citizen Science Initiatives

Citizen science initiatives have revolutionized marine research by creating meaningful connections between scientists and the public. These programs enable everyday citizens to contribute to vital marine conservation efforts while gaining hands-on experience in scientific research methods. Popular projects include coral reef monitoring, where volunteers conduct underwater surveys to assess reef health, and marine mammal tracking programs that help researchers understand migration patterns.

Notable initiatives include Reef Check, which trains recreational divers to collect data on coral reef ecosystems worldwide, and REEF’s Fish Survey Project, allowing snorkelers and divers to document fish populations. Beach cleanup programs combine data collection with direct environmental action, as participants not only remove debris but also record types and quantities of marine litter to support pollution research.

Smartphone apps and online platforms have made participation more accessible than ever. Programs like iNaturalist and Marine Debris Tracker enable citizens to report wildlife sightings and document marine pollution from anywhere in the world. These technological tools have created vast databases that researchers use to track environmental changes and biodiversity trends.

The impact of citizen science extends beyond data collection. Participants often become passionate advocates for marine conservation, sharing their experiences within their communities and inspiring others to get involved. Educational institutions frequently partner with these initiatives, providing students with real-world research experience while contributing to scientific understanding of marine ecosystems.

Virtual and Distance Learning Options

Virtual marine education has revolutionized access to ocean science learning, breaking down geographical barriers and making marine knowledge available to anyone with an internet connection. Leading institutions like the Monterey Bay Aquarium and the National Oceanic and Atmospheric Administration (NOAA) now offer comprehensive online courses, virtual field trips, and interactive webinars that bring ocean ecosystems directly to students’ screens.

Live-streaming technology has become particularly impactful, with underwater cameras broadcasting real-time footage from coral reefs, kelp forests, and marine sanctuaries. Students can observe marine life in their natural habitats while participating in guided discussions with marine biologists and oceanographers.

Digital learning platforms now feature sophisticated 3D modeling and virtual reality experiences, allowing participants to “dive” into ocean environments and interact with marine species in immersive ways. These tools are especially valuable for studying deep-sea ecosystems that would be impossible to visit physically.

Many programs offer flexible learning schedules and self-paced modules, making them accessible to working professionals and students in different time zones. Virtual workshops focus on crucial topics like marine conservation, climate change impacts, and sustainable fishing practices, often incorporating citizen science projects that enable participants to contribute to real research efforts from home.

For educators, these platforms provide ready-to-use curriculum materials, lesson plans, and professional development opportunities, helping them integrate marine science into their teaching more effectively.

Getting Involved

Finding the Right Program

When selecting a marine education program, consider your specific interests within marine science, whether it’s marine biology, conservation, oceanography, or marine policy. Look for programs accredited by recognized marine science institutions and those offering hands-on experience through field work or laboratory research.

Program duration is crucial – options range from weekend workshops to year-long courses. Consider your availability and learning goals when choosing. Location matters too; coastal programs often provide direct access to marine environments, while inland programs might offer unique technological resources or specialized research facilities.

Evaluate the program’s curriculum against your career objectives. Some focus on research skills, while others emphasize practical conservation techniques or public education. Check if the program offers networking opportunities with marine professionals and research institutions.

Budget considerations should include not only tuition but also equipment costs, field trip expenses, and potential certification fees. Many programs offer scholarships or work-study options – investigate these early in your search.

Finally, read reviews from past participants and reach out to program alumni. Their experiences can provide valuable insights into the program’s strengths and challenges.

Resources and Support

Numerous organizations and institutions provide valuable support for marine education initiatives. The National Oceanic and Atmospheric Administration (NOAA) offers grants and educational resources through their Sea Grant program, supporting both students and educators. The Ocean Foundation provides fellowships and research funding opportunities for emerging marine scientists and educators.

For students seeking financial assistance, the Marine Technology Society (MTS) awards annual scholarships ranging from $1,000 to $8,000. The American Academy of Underwater Sciences (AAUS) offers research grants and internship opportunities for undergraduate and graduate students interested in marine research.

Regional support networks include coastal marine laboratories, aquariums, and science centers that frequently partner with educational institutions. The Sea Grant Network maintains a database of marine education opportunities across coastal states, while organizations like the National Marine Educators Association (NMEA) connect professionals through conferences and workshops.

Online resources include Marine-Ed.org, which provides curriculum materials and professional development opportunities, and the Bridge Ocean Sciences Education Resource Center, offering free educational materials and lesson plans for marine science educators.
